If you haven't done it yet, go to a 8k clutch spring. It will help out a lot with that bottom end bog.
 
yeh ive actually already ordered one. broke the shaft on my gear(my fault), so ive already got it torn down and waiting to install. ive heard that you have to remove some of the red covering on the spring to install it, is this right?

yeh ive actually already ordered one. broke the shaft on my gear(my fault), so ive already got it torn down and waiting to install. ive heard that you have to remove some of the red covering on the spring to install it, is this right?
Yes. It is a tight fit to get the spring ends through the holes in the clutch shoes. Shaving the paint off makes it a little easier.

well I got a chance to install king motor dominator pipe yesterday and found that quite a few mods would have to be done to get the roll cage and wing to work. thing is I still wanted to try it out for performance. I've got to say it ran really well up to the point where I rolled it. broke plug, ripped up plug boot, and pulled one of the bolts holding the pipe on right out of the head. moral of this story. not a good idea to run without cage and a very good idea to have flexible joint in pipe. with the cpi big bore pipe I seem to have a little lag on low end takeoff but great top end after it winds up. with the king pipe the low end lag was gone. what I was wondering is with the cpi's two big exit ports if this might be to much for the esp ported head and If blocking one might help. what do you guys think.
